Whilst it will be April before we get to see Shazam, some lucky individuals have already seen the movie and are now allowed to share their reactions on social media. As we often do, we have gathered a selection of reactions to share with you below.
The general consensus from all the reactions I have read (of which this is but a selection) are all positive. In fact, I normally try to find something negative to counter all this damn positivity and couldn’t really find anything yet. I included the only post I can find with a slight criticism, but it is only that.

So it appears as if Shazam is a hit with critics so far, with many saying this is one of the most fun movies they’ve seen in a while. I said the other day that I felt a little uneasy and wasn’t sure if this would work for me personally. However, claims that the film has great heart, genuine scary moments, and great performances make me think twice.
I still think Shazam is opening in an awful window and would have been better serviced coming out earlier or later. It remains sandwiched in between Captain Marvel and Avengers: Endgame and that’s not where I’d like to be. Hopefully, if the movie is as good as people say, this will be another success for the DCEU and ensure we get even more DC movies in the future.
